Default Re: Spray paint can MISSING ball inside!! (GuNnErGoD)

that's usually the case, a stuck ball. the reason the ball is in there is to mix up the separated materials.. when it sits on a shelf for a long time it gets the thick **** built up on the bottom of the can and the ball gets stuck. like GuNnErGoD said, hit the bottom. what i do instead of hitting it on the floor, is i hit it on the bottom of my shoe. whack the **** out of it and it won't damage the can!
